Verdict: On MOT pass rate, the Volvo S40 is the more reliable of the two — 70% pass first time versus 61%. It's one signal among several; check the full breakdown below.
Head to head
| Measure | Volvo S40 | Volvo Xc 90 d5 se awd semi-auto |
|---|---|---|
| MOT pass rate | 70% ✓ | 61% |
| MOT failure rate | 30% ✓ | 39% |
| Faults & advisories per test | 2.1 | 0.0 ✓ |
| Dangerous-fault share | 1% | — ✓ |
| Average mileage | 123,409 mi | 179,864 mi |
| Sample size (vehicles) | 104,637 | 341 |
